A never-before-seen virus has touched down in Alabama, which well being specialists are sounding alarms about.

The Camp Hill virus is from the identical household because the lethal Nipah and Hendra viruses, that are a few of the most dangerous lively viruses on the earth, killing about 70% of individuals contaminated.

Australian researchers discovered the virus in shrews, a mole-like animal, in Tallapoosa County, Alabama.

Dr. David Dyjack, unrelated to the examine, spoke to the DailyMail and provided a scary evaluation of the virus.

“What considerations us in public well being is we’ve got this virus with [we believe] a really excessive mortality price, and if it had been to mutate and transmit to a human, and assault the kidneys, as we have seen in some animals, that could possibly be notably threatening to all of mankind,” Dr. Dyjack, a public well being knowledgeable on the Nationwide Environmental Well being Affiliation, stated.

“I might say that there are three issues that maintain me up at night time: One is a nuclear conflict. The second is the implications of a altering local weather, and the third is a world pandemic. The Camp Hill virus sits squarely within the bullseye of the pandemic concern,” he added.

The virus continues to be new, which implies new research are wanted into the consequences on people, as an individual has but to be contaminated.

Different viruses in the identical household could cause spinal twine and mind irritation, swelling, respiratory misery, kidney injury, and liver injury.

Early indications are that the virus could be transmitted from shrews to people, which may result in a harmful pandemic. Comparable viruses to the Camp Hil virus are sometimes unfold by bodily fluids or shut contact with an contaminated celebration.

“For one thing like this, if it is airborne, that causes me nice misery as a public well being skilled,” Dyjack stated.

The virus doesn’t essentially pose a right away risk, as it could seemingly must mutate additional to develop into a big risk.

“There’s extra that we do not know than we all know because it pertains to public well being, as tissue and human well being. On the face of it, that’s alarming, notably because it has been recognized inside the homeland.”
